Israel Strikes Iran’s Cyber Warfare Headquarters in Tehran

The Israel Defense Forces (IDF) reportedly destroyed Iran’s cyber warfare headquarters, its Intelligence Directorate, and other key military units in a targeted airstrike on a Tehran-based compound. The operation, disclosed by The Cyber Express, marks a significant escalation in the ongoing conflict between the two nations, though further details of the strike remain undisclosed.

Cybersecurity analysts, including those from Cyble, caution that the physical destruction of the facility is unlikely to cripple Iran’s cyber capabilities. State-backed threat actors increasingly rely on distributed infrastructure and encrypted communications, allowing operations to persist even after high-profile disruptions. Researchers note that recent cyber activity has been more anticipatory than destructive, though the gap between current actions and the full capabilities of both sides remains a critical concern.

Prior to the joint U.S.-Israel missile strikes, Iran had already established attack infrastructure, suggesting preparedness for retaliatory measures. In the aftermath, hacktivist groups including those linked to Iraq and Russia have launched distributed denial-of-service (DDoS) attacks as part of broader retaliatory efforts. The incident underscores the evolving intersection of kinetic and cyber warfare in the region.
